
vivo is gearing up for the launch of the vivo S20 Series in China and has confirmed its launch date and some key specs. Comprising the vivo S20 and vivo S20 Pro, read on to find out more.
Taking to its official Weibo account, vivo announced that the S20 Series will debut in China on 28 November at 7pm local time. Further hyping up the release, vivo has also revealed that the S20 will be powered by the Qualcomm Snapdragon 7 Gen 3 SoC, while the Pro variant features the MediaTek Dimensity 9300+ chipset.

Both devices feature a massive 6500mAh battery despite having a thickness of 7.19mm and weighing 180g. Furthermore, the Pro variant sports quad 50MP cameras, including the selfie shooter and a 1.5K curved display.
For the full specs and pricing, we just have to wait until 28 November. Do note that the S20 Series will be exclusive to China, though they may end up in other markets with a different name and package.
